How Our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Service Actually Works
Our process for sewage cleanup and disinfection is meticulous and science-driven. We don’t cut corners or rush through the job, because we know that’s when mistakes happen.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ure every step is completed safely and effectively. That means using moisture meters to detect hidden water, drying equipment to speed up evaporation, and containment procedures to pr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We start by assessing the extent of the backup and containing the affected area to prevent further damage.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and moisture, identifying the source of the problem.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Next, we extract the water and begin the drying process. Our equipment is designed to speed up evaporation and reduce damage to your property.
Step 3: Disinfection and Decontamination
Once the water is gone, we disinfect and decontaminate your property to ensure a safe environment for you and your family.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to remove b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Finally, we repair and restore your property to its original condition. Our team works with you to identify the root cause of the problem and set up measures to prevent future backups.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ost in Edina, MN
The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ection can vary depending on the severity of the backup,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of backup, local conditions |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water extracted, type of equipment used, drying time |
| Disinfection and Decontamination |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of disinfection equipment used, level of contamination |
| Repair and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Extent of damage, type of repairs needed, materials used |
| More Services (e.g. Plumbing repairs, drywall repair) | $500 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of repairs needed, materials used |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and may vary based on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and are happy to discuss your options with you.

Common Questions About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ection
Q: What causes sewage backups?
A: Sewage backups can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ged pipes, tree roots, and heavy rainfall. Our team can help you identify the root cause of the problem and set up measures to prevent future backups.
Q: How long does sewage cleanup and disinfection take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ete sewage cleanup and disinfection depends on the severity of the backup and the size of the affected area.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.
Q: Is sewage cleanup and disinfection covered by insurance?
A: In some cases, sewage cleanup and disinfection may be covered by insurance. But, coverage depends on the specifics of your policy and the circumstances surrounding the backup. Our team can help you navigate the insurance process and ensure you get the coverage you need.
Q: Can I prevent sewage backups from happening in the first place?
A: Yes!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ent sewage backups from occurring. Our team can provide you with tips and recommendations for maintaining your plumbing system and preventing future backups.
